What do teams get wrong about building frictionless user experiences for modern SaaS customers?

Teams often assume a good demo is enough, then discover that modern customers expect self-service onboarding, easy access control, advanced settings, and compliance visibility without support tickets. The common mistake is treating user experience as cosmetic instead of core product infrastructure. If those capabilities are missing, adoption stalls and expansion becomes harder.

Why This Matters for Security Teams

Frictionless SaaS is not just about pretty screens or fewer clicks. For modern buyers, the experience has to remove work across onboarding, access, settings, and assurance. If users still need support tickets to provision access, manage roles, or understand compliance posture, the product feels unfinished even when the core feature set is strong. That creates adoption friction, slows expansion, and makes procurement harder to defend internally.

The mistake teams make is confusing demo smoothness with operational self-service. A customer may love a walkthrough, then hit delays the moment they try to add teammates, connect systems, or review controls. That gap becomes a trust problem, because the product is now asking the customer to absorb hidden operational cost. In practice, many teams discover that the first real complaint is not about functionality, but about the time and approvals required to use it.

Security teams should treat that gap as part of product infrastructure, not a cosmetic concern. A frictionless experience depends on clear permissions, predictable workflows, visible settings, and an assurance story customers can verify without waiting on support. When those pieces are absent, users create workarounds, and workarounds are where governance and adoption both start to degrade. In practice, many security teams encounter the real UX problem only after customers begin escalating access requests instead of completing tasks themselves.

How It Works in Practice

In practice, frictionless SaaS UX is built by making the highest-frequency customer actions self-service, safe, and understandable. That usually means a customer can sign up, invite teammates, assign roles, configure integrations, and review security or compliance settings without a manual back-and-forth. The product should guide the user through the minimum viable path first, then expose advanced controls when they are needed, not when the support team is available.

A strong implementation usually has three layers:

  • Onboarding that gets a new tenant to first value quickly, with minimal dependency on human intervention.
  • Access control that lets administrators manage users and permissions without waiting for support or engineering.
  • Transparent settings and evidence that let buyers validate data handling, logging, and compliance posture on their own.

That third layer matters more than many product teams expect. In SaaS buying cycles, buyers increasingly expect proof, not promises, so security and compliance visibility become part of the experience itself. When teams hide controls behind tickets or vague documentation, they push security into the sales process and turn it into friction. A more mature pattern is to present policy summaries, audit evidence, and configuration status inside the product, so the customer can make decisions without a separate escalation path.

Where this goes wrong is when teams optimize only for the first session and ignore the full customer lifecycle. A product can feel effortless on day one and still become operationally heavy at day thirty if role changes, integration setup, billing adjustments, or compliance reviews require manual intervention. SaaS experiences break down when the product design assumes a single admin path, because real customers need repeatable self-service across multiple teams, environments, and approval boundaries.

Common Variations and Edge Cases

Tighter control often increases setup overhead, so organisations have to balance ease of use against governance, auditability, and tenant safety. The right answer is not to remove controls, but to design them so customers can understand and use them without losing visibility or overexposing the tenant.

Some customers want maximum autonomy, while regulated buyers want stronger review steps and richer evidence. Those are not the same experience, and best practice is evolving toward adaptive UX that changes by tenant risk, role, and maturity. A startup customer may accept a lightweight path, while an enterprise buyer may require approvals, audit trails, and more detailed configuration surfaces.

Another edge case is the difference between self-service and unsafe self-service. Letting customers change permissions, invite users, or connect tools is valuable only if the product constrains blast radius and makes the outcome legible. If a control is too opaque, teams may simplify it for the demo but later discover that administrators cannot explain what changed, who approved it, or why a setting is active. The most resilient frictionless designs make the common path obvious and the risky path deliberate, without forcing every action through support.

Practitioner Guidance

What to prioritise: Focus first on the actions customers repeat most often after the demo, especially onboarding, access changes, and visibility into status or controls. If those flows still require support, the product is not frictionless even if the initial sale feels smooth.

What to verify: Test the experience with a real buyer, an administrator, and an end user. Each should be able to complete the core journey without hidden knowledge, internal escalation, or a vendor-assisted step that only exists to make the demo work.

Common mistake: Teams often overinvest in polished presentation layers and underinvest in the operational paths that determine whether customers stay. The signal to watch is how often success depends on a human explaining the product instead of the product explaining itself.

Practitioner takeaway: Frictionless SaaS is an operational design problem, not a visual one, and the best test is whether customers can adopt, govern, and trust the product without needing a support queue to bridge the gaps.
